Consistent with the notion of role modeling, leaders with promotion-focused behavior are found to induce promotion focus in followers (Wu, McMullen, Neubert & Yi, 2008). We tap into social cognitive theory and posit that transformational leaders as role models induce promotion focus in followers. WebAmong the core traits identified are: Drive —a high level of effort, including a strong desire for achievement as well as high levels of ambition, energy, tenacity, and initiative. Leadership motivation —an intense desire to lead others. Honesty and integrity —a commitment to the truth (nondeceit), where word and deed correspond.
